Wednesday 1st April - Financial Fools' Day at 12 noon.
*MERCi Carrot Mobbing*
The *Co-operative* Bank, Balloon Street, Manchester.
“Many people of course will be in London's Square Mile on Financial
Fools'
Day highlighting the horrors of the financial industry. Here at MERCi
we're always trying to focus on the good, and good deeds should be
rewarded.
MERCi staff and friends will be presenting The *Co-operative* Bank with
the first ever MERCi-Carrot. The MERCi-Carrot is a reward for continually
working towards improvements with respect for the environment and social
justice. The MERCi-Carrot will be presented to The *Co-operative* Bank in
the form of a MERCi Carrot Cake and Certificate.
For a successful carrot mobbing, we need a mob. A BIG mob. And it must
be a surprise!!! So please come down to the first ever MERCi Carrot
Mobbing and help us thank The *Co-operative* Bank for their efforts.
